Description

Taught by Rice University communication faculty from the Rice Center for Engineering Leadership (RCEL). This course covers core topics in oral communication: Communication strategy, content, data visualization, and delivery. You’ll learn key principles in

Summary of User Reviews

The Oral Communication course on Coursera has received positive reviews from many users. The course has been praised for its engaging content and practical exercises that help improve public speaking skills. However, some users have mentioned that the course could benefit from more interaction with instructors and peers. Overall, the course has been rated highly by users for its ability to help individuals become confident and effective communicators.
